Detailed overview: Steca PR 2020 IP65 weatherproof charge controller

The Steca PR 2020 IP65 is a PWM solar charge controller developed by the German manufacturer Steca (Kontron/Katek group), part of its professional PR range. Its defining feature is an enclosure rated IP65, specifically designed to work in demanding environments, high salt content, humidity or dust, where a standard controller would degrade quickly.

Technically it shares the same base as the PR range: PWM technology with shunt MOSFET topology, automatic detection of the system voltage (12V or 24V), and up to 20A of charge and load current. With a panel open-circuit voltage capped at 47V, it handles roughly 240W of panels at 12V and 480W at 24V. The heart of the controller is its self-adaptive Steca AtonIC state-of-charge algorithm, which shows the battery's charge percentage on a graphic LCD screen, as both a gauge and a numeric value.

The weatherproof enclosure includes three cable glands for the module, battery and load leads, and houses the electronics behind a screwed, transparent lid. It packs a data logger with energy meter, programmable dusk and night-light functions, and a built-in self-test. On the protection side, it carries the full Steca lineup: overcharge, deep discharge, reverse polarity (module, load, battery), automatic electronic fuse, short circuit, reverse current protection at night, and disconnection on battery overvoltage. The controller is certified for tropical-climate use (DIN IEC 68 part 2-30 standard), and operates from 14 °F to 122 °F (-10 °C to +50 °C).

Its limits: no Bluetooth connectivity or mobile app, a screen less rich than a recent MPPT controller, and a price well above the non-weatherproof PR 2020 for the same 20A rating. But for a marine, agricultural, building-site or any exposed outdoor installation, the IP65 rating genuinely changes the equation against a standard controller.

The Steca PR 2020 IP65 joined a sailboat's solar setup, where humidity and sea spray finish off most standard controllers within a couple of seasons. Its clear weatherproof enclosure lets you see the electronics inside and screws firmly to the bulkhead, with three cable glands for the module, battery and load leads. The LCD screen clearly shows the charge percentage thanks to the AtonIC algorithm, with no technical jargon to decode. The tropical-use certification is reassuring for long-term humid-climate durability. The downsides: no Bluetooth or app, the screen stays basic compared with recent MPPT controllers, and the price runs well above a non-weatherproof PR 2020 for the same 20A rating. But for marine, agricultural or outdoor building-site use, that IP65 rating clearly justifies the price gap over a standard controller that would eventually give up the ghost.
